Convergence of logistics potential
Developing seaports and logistics services - one of the economic pillars of the Central Key Economic Zone. Located in this key economic zone, Quang Nam province has a favorable position to become a regional logistics and freight transit center.
Quang Nam is a locality with a large area, long coastline, large population; abundant natural resources, favorable geographical location, complete transport infrastructure system to connect with provinces and cities in the country and the region...
Mr. Ho Quang Buu, Vice Chairman of the People's Committee of Quang Nam province, said that the province is located in a strategic position in the Central Key Economic Zone. To the north is Da Nang City, to the south is Dung Quat Economic Zone, and at the same time is the gateway to the sea for the Central Highlands, and a little further is Central and Southern Laos. Therefore, there are many favorable conditions to become a logistics center of the region.
In the logistics development strategy, Quang Nam identifies Chu Lai port as having a very important position. Because the port has a convenient traffic location, directly connecting to National Highway 1, the coastal road, the Da Nang - Quang Ngai expressway and large economic zones and industrial parks such as Tam Thang Industrial Park, Bac Chu Lai Industrial Park, Dung Quat Economic Zone (Quang Ngai); connecting to Southern Laos, Northeast Thailand via Nam Giang international border gate.

In recent years, Chu Lai port's infrastructure and equipment have been heavily invested in the direction of developing a complete service chain, while also being able to exploit a variety of goods. According to data from the Quang Nam Provincial People's Committee, Chu Lai port currently receives 30,000 DWT ships; the warehouse system at the port has also been upgraded and expanded with an area of over 154,000 m2. Up to now, the port has gradually become a large logistics center serving the needs of delivery, transportation, import and export of businesses in the Central and Central Highlands regions. In addition, Quang Nam also has Ky Ha port, which receives 15,000 DWT ships. The volume of goods passing through Ky Ha port and Chu Lai port reaches over 5 million tons/year.
In addition, the operation of Nam Giang international border gate has opened up many new opportunities for economic, trade and tourism cooperation between the Central Key Economic Zone and localities in the Central and Southern Laos regions, and also connecting to Thailand. This border gate also contributes to attracting international investors to the region, supporting the development of the East-West economic corridor.

Along with the seaport and road, Quang Nam also has Chu Lai airport with an area of 2,300 hectares, 2 runways for landing and take-off with a total length of 4,877m. Chu Lai airport is planned to become an international airport with a scale, airport level 4E, designed capacity to serve passengers from 5 to 10 million passengers/year in the period of 2021 - 2030 and by 2050 to become an international gateway airport (replacing Da Nang airport), designed capacity to serve passengers reaching 40 million passengers/year.
At the same time, the logistics center is planned in combination with Chu Lai airport, flight training center, aircraft maintenance and repair center and other activities associated with the duty-free zone.
Addressing the challenges
In parallel, with the available advantages recently, to develop the logistics sector, Quang Nam also prioritizes investment in infrastructure development, connecting main traffic routes between the expressway with national and provincial highways, district and provincial roads, and coastal routes. Up to now, the national highways connecting Nam Giang International Border Gate such as 14D, 14B, 14E... have all been invested and upgraded by the locality to meet the demand for connecting goods in the region.
In addition, with the Chu Lai Open Economic Zone Industrial Center and the developed automobile and supporting industries, it also contributes to making Quang Nam gradually become a major maritime transport center, an important logistics hub in the Central region...

According to the planning of Quang Nam province for the period 2021-2030, with a vision to 2050, industrial development will follow the direction of circular economy, specialization, and high automation; rapidly increase the contribution of processing and manufacturing industry and become the main pillar in the economy.
Promote the development of automobile manufacturing and assembly industry, mechanical, electrical and electronic products; form a national multi-purpose mechanical and automobile center, develop supporting industries associated with logistics services, seaport, airport and railway logistics. Chu Lai Open Economic Zone becomes a dynamic economic zone of the region and the country.
Despite the advantages, the development of logistics services in Quang Nam still has "bottlenecks", including the unsynchronized transport infrastructure system, lack of connectivity, and low information application. Some road traffic projects are slow to implement, and seaport infrastructure is not as expected. The number of enterprises operating in the logistics sector is still small and small in scale. Quang Nam has not yet attracted large logistics enterprises to participate in the provincial and regional markets.

In particular, although Nam Giang international border gate has been upgraded to an international border gate, its infrastructure is still not synchronous, border trade services have not developed, the power grid system at the border gate area is unstable, there is no physical inspection area for goods and no warehouse for gathering import and export goods, making it difficult for businesses as well as authorities to carry out customs procedures.
Recently, at the Conference on Announcing the Planning of Quang Nam Province for the period 2021-2030 with a vision to 2050, Mr. Tran Ba Duong, Chairman of the Board of Directors of Truong Hai Group Joint Stock Company (Thaco) said that logistics costs in Quang Nam are still 20% higher than in the other two ends of the country. To solve this key issue, we have imported components for production, assembly, and then export. However, Thaco's export goods are still lacking.
To solve the shortage of exported goods, Thaco has participated in developing large-scale cultivation models in Laos, Cambodia and the Central Highlands. With the development of agriculture, by the end of this year the company will have about 1,000 tons of fresh fruit/day for export and next year about 2,000 tons/day. Thus, on average, Thaco has from 100 to 200 export containers per day, contributing to solving the shortage of exported goods...

According to many economic experts, to develop logistics services, Quang Nam needs to be more determined in developing and implementing key solutions to improve connectivity efficiency and reduce transportation and logistics costs. It is necessary to focus on coordinating with central ministries and branches as well as promoting investment and soon putting into operation key connecting traffic infrastructure on the corridor such as the North-South Expressway, National Highway 14D, National Highway 14E connecting Nam Giang international border gate and Lien Chieu wharf area (Da Nang)...
At the same time, Quang Nam also needs to coordinate with other localities to develop breakthrough policy mechanisms to attract potential businesses and investors in the logistics sector. Form an inter-regional coordination mechanism to assign tasks and functions to each locality in the logistics service supply chain in the region. Only then will the dream of becoming a logistics center of Quang Nam soon come true.
